 Central Texas Junior Golf Association
JUNIOR TEAM GOLF

AN OVERVIEW

 Here a few simple ground rules:

 A team is five players and scoring is like the NCAA, best four out of five scores count.

Play is on a scratch basis and kids are handicapped with yardage allowance based on age.

You register your team through the CTJGA for each event and pay on game day.

You may enter as many distinct teams as you wish first come first serve.

Kids walk but we use common sense in shuttling when available.

If a team is short and there are single players available the singles will be placed on teams as guests.

Any help by you in organization, rules, and marshalling is appreciated.

The CTJGA does not buy lunch; spectator carts are the responsibility of the spectator; charging for range balls is at the discretion of the facility;

no practice rounds are promised.

    Hi!

Summer golf leagues for high school golfers aren't always the easiest things to find unless you're a member of a private country club. In an effort to keep those competitive juices flowing, Foresight Golf is forming leagues at all 3 courses.

League Details

The summer leagues will include a 1-hour practice each week, a team shirt and 5 tournaments with prizes. Each team member will enjoy playing privileges at their home course which include 3 large buckets of balls per day and course time after 3:30 Monday through Thursday and after 4 pm on Friday through Sunday.
